Avian Flu Surge Prompts Expanded State Response

Pennsylvania is facing a surge in Highly Pathogenic Avian Influenza, jeopardizing the state’s $7.1 billion industry. In response, officials are mobilizing personnel, expanding laboratory testing, and allocating millions of dollars in emergency funds. This decisive action underscores the urgent need to safeguard agricultural health and public safety.
